katoikia denotes the bounded place where nations live in Acts 17:26.
The attested use refers to the place of habitation whose boundaries are described in relation to the nations in Acts 17:26.
Senses in use
-
Place of habitation within set boundaries · dominant
In Acts 17:26, the genitive singular feminine form occurs in the clause about God determining the nations' appointed times and the boundaries of their place of habitation; the APB renders the clause "the boundaries of their dwelling place."
